BLOODWORTH
BLOODWORTH is a Texas oil lease in Jack County, Railroad Commission district 09, operated by Lufkin Production Company Inc.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from January 1993 to August 2026, totalling 286 barrels. The lease is intermittent. Fitting a decline curve to that history and pricing the remaining production at today's forward curve values the whole lease — a 100% undivided interest — at about $13K, with roughly $3K expected over the next twelve months. An individual royalty owner receives their own decimal interest times that figure. Over the last twelve months on file it averaged 3 barrels a month. Its strongest month on the record we hold was January 2023, at 20 barrels. In our own backtest, leases producing at this rate are forecast to within about 100% of what they went on to produce, and that measured error is the range shown on the page rather than a confidence of our own devising.

- How much is BLOODWORTH worth?
- The remaining production from BLOODWORTH is estimated to be worth about $13K in total as of 26 August 2026, within a range of $0 to $26K. That figure is the whole lease, undivided — not any one owner's share. A royalty interest in BLOODWORTH is a fraction of it. The estimate fits an Arps decline curve to the production BLOODWORTH has already reported, prices the remaining production at the current forward strip, and discounts it at 12% a year. The figure shown for BLOODWORTH is an estimate of value, not an offer and not an appraisal.
